Petroleum Coke
Petroleum Coke
Petroleum Coke (Petcoke) contains over 80% carbon and when burned, it produces 5% to 10% more carbon dioxide (CO2) per unit of energy than coal. Petcoke emits between 30% and 80% more CO2 per unit of weight than coal due to its greater energy content.

Processed Cashew Nuts
Processed Cashew Nuts
Nutrient Amount(g) DV(%) Total Fat 44 g 67% Cholesterol 0 mg 0% Sodium 12 mg 0% Potassium 660 mg 18% Total Carbohydrate 30 g 10% Protein 18 g 36% Processed Cashew Nuts Grading
Grades of cashew kernels include splits, butts, and white or burned wholes. Depending on the kernel’s size, shape, and color. Cashew kernels come in many different grades, but only a handful are exchanged and sold professionally. As follows:
- The “King of Cashews,” also known as W 180, is bigger and more costly.
- Jumbo’nuts, also known as W – 210, are very common.
- W – 240 is a desirable grade that is cost-effective.
- The most widely used and most widely available cashew kernels globally are W – 320.
- The most popular of the low cost whole grades is W-450 because it has the tiniest and most affordable white whole kernels.

Rapeseed Oil
Features Of Rapeseed Oil
Different TAG, fatty acid, phospholipid, and unsaponifiable components can be found in rapeseed oil. Phospholipids readily migrate into the extracted oil during the processing of rapeseeds and oil pressing because of membrane breakdown brought on by mechanical and/or heat disintegration of the membranes. The previous study found that rapeseed oil that was cold-pressed and kept at temperatures below 45°C had a low phosphorus content ( 20 mg/kg), whereas oil that was heated during pressing and that came from seeds that had been conditioned at various temperatures had a high phosphorus content ( 125–476 mg/kg).

RBD Palm Oil
Features Of RBD Palm Oil
Palm oil that has been refined, bleached, and deodorized (RBD) is semisolid at room temperature, bland, odorless, and a light yellow hue, making it a perfect substitute for partly hydrogenated oils in many snacks and baked goods.

Sulphur
Sulphur
Pure sulfur is a tasteless, odorless, brittle solid with a pale yellow color that is insoluble in water and a poor conductor of electricity. It creates sulfides when it reacts with all metals, save gold and platinum, and it also does so when it interacts with a number of nonmetallic elements.

Sunflower Oil
Features Of Sunflower Oil
Due to its low level of saturated fats, high concentration of PUFAs and monounsaturated fatty acids, and presence of vitamin E, sunflower oil is a healthy oil. Because of its excellent oxidative stability, high-oleic sunflower oil is appropriate for use in commercial frying.
